ivan wrote:I never got why Indian vills costed wood, it''s like they really ran out of ideas.
It''s very comparable to Dutch Settlers costing coin to me. What I don''t like is Indians starting with Water Wheel and Regenerative Forestry as well as cheaper houses. I''d rather just have a higher base gathering rate instead of those three bonuses, as Dutch do.

What I would like though is for Indians'' shipments not to deliver Villagers and then one of the following:

1. Shipment penalty removed.
2. Shipments deliver a tri-res trickle whose size varies according to the age of the shipment sent.
3. Shipments deliver Sepoys starting in the Colonial Age. Indians'' Distibutivism home-city shipment increased from 1.25 to 1.75 wood per second.
